// shareFile uploads a file to a running helmd and returns the share id.
func shareFile(server, token, path, note, session string) (string, error) {
f, err := os.Open(path)
if err != nil {
return "", err
}
defer f.Close()
var buf bytes.Buffer
mw := multipart.NewWriter(&buf)
fw, err := mw.CreateFormFile("file", filepath.Base(path))
if err != nil {
return "", err
}
if _, err := io.Copy(fw, f); err != nil {
return "", err
}
mw.WriteField("note", note)
mw.WriteField("session", session)
mw.Close()
req, err := http.NewRequest("POST", server+"/api/shares", &buf)
if err != nil {
return "", err
}
req.Header.Set("Content-Type", mw.FormDataContentType())
req.Header.Set("Authorization", "Bearer "+token)
client := &http.Client{Timeout: 60 * time.Second}
resp, err := client.Do(req)
if err != nil {
return "", err
}
defer resp.Body.Close()
body, _ := io.ReadAll(io.LimitReader(resp.Body, 1<<20))
if resp.StatusCode >= 300 {
return "", fmt.Errorf("servern svarade %s: %s", resp.Status, bytes.TrimSpace(body))
}
var out struct {
ID string `json:"id"`
}
if err := json.Unmarshal(body, &out); err != nil {
return "", err
}
return out.ID, nil
}
